Linda E. Fields of Miami, OK, went to be with her Lord and her sweetie and other loved ones Wednesday March 16, 2011 at Barnes Jewish Hospital in St. Louis, MO. She was 65.
Mrs. Fields was born April 27, 1945 in Stella, AR, to John Paul and Zilla (Walker) Moudy. She had lived in Miami all her life and was a member of the First Free Will Baptist Church in Quapaw, Ok. Linda retired from B.F. Goodrich and worked at Miami Laundry and Dry Cleaning as a seamstress.

She married Jerry Lee Fields May 11, 1985 and he preceded her in death on January 8, 2009. She was also preceded by her parents, 2 sisters June Phillips and Paula Morris and a brother Connes Ray Moudy.

Survivors includes
2 Sons Richard Gering of Miami, OK,
Lance Sumpter and wife Sharon of Ponchatoula, LA,
Daughter Mary Sue Gering of Miami, OK
2 Brothers John Paul Moudy, Jr. and wife Pam of Kansas City, MO,
Robert Moudy of Miami, OK,
Sister Mary Rarick and husband Walt of Wichita Falls, TX,
4 Grandchildren Zachary Levi Gering, Michael Lee Gering, Joshua Sumpter and Melinda Johnson
Numerous Nieces and Nephews
Funeral Services will be Tuesday March 22, 2011 at 10:00 a.m. at the Paul Thomas Funeral Home in Miami, OK. Rev. Robert Nutting and Rev. Robert Cody will officiate. Pallbearers will be Stacy Greenfeather, Donnie Greenfeather, Josh Bear, Jeff Garrett, Billy Huff and Robert Leeds. The family will receive friends from 6 to 7 p.m. Monday evening at the funeral home. Interment will be in G.A.R. Cemetery in Miami, OK. Services are under the direction of Paul Thomas Funeral Home of Miami, OK. Online condolences may be made at www.paulthomasfuneralhomes.com
